Transaction 7837518cff843d81d01530f5b1f7e054a6e16c5607c698e944c43b7d48b04bef
1 Input
2 Outputs
- 7837518cff843d81d01530f5b1f7e054a6e16c5607c698e944c43b7d48b04bef:0
- 7837518cff843d81d01530f5b1f7e054a6e16c5607c698e944c43b7d48b04bef:1
value 15890000
address 1DpRUjPiWg193bdZk4nzRdiAu45CtgEzHM
value 10751242
address 19jJQUDC8ZRt5GGm6ep483PjSHnoPSfPuJ